Penn State's D.J. Newbill Ejected For Shoving Kendrick Nunn In Neck
Plays like this always make me think about the existence of a textbook for broadcasters. "It's always the second guy who gets caught" would be in Chapter 1, along with a section on Aikmanisms like "...and I'm not so sure they didn't do just that, Joe." Anyway, D.J. Newbill was the second guy here—this was also his second scuffle with an Illini today—and was ejected.
After a slashing layup, Nunn ran right into Newbill, pushing his arms out and Newbill turned around, responding with a violent shove to the back of Nunn's neck or head. The benches nearly cleared, coaches scampered and lots of posturing followed. Order was eventually restored and the game proceeded, minus the presence of Newbill.
